The internet is a powerful tool when searching for “car insurance near me.” Several websites and online tools can streamline your search:
Many websites allow you to compare quotes from multiple insurance providers simultaneously. These tools often ask for basic information about your vehicle, driving history, and desired coverage, then present you with a range of options. This is an excellent way to quickly get an overview of available rates and coverage options. Remember to check the reviews of any comparison website before using it.
Searching “car insurance near me” on Google Maps or other search engines will display local insurance agencies. Contacting these agencies directly allows you to discuss your specific needs with an agent and get personalized quotes. This approach offers a more personal touch and the opportunity to ask detailed questions.
Most major insurance companies have user-friendly websites where you can get quotes and compare plans. This method provides direct access to the insurer’s information and policies, allowing you to review details thoroughly before making a decision. Look at their customer reviews and ratings to gauge their reputation.
Several factors influence the cost of your car insurance. Understanding these factors can help you make informed choices and potentially lower your premiums:
A clean driving record is crucial for obtaining lower insurance rates. Accidents, traffic violations, and DUI convictions can significantly increase your premiums. Maintaining a safe driving record is the best way to keep your costs down.
Statistically, younger drivers and certain genders are considered higher risk, leading to higher insurance premiums. This is a factor you cannot control but should be aware of when comparing quotes.
In many states, your credit score is a factor in determining your insurance rates. A good credit score is often associated with lower premiums. Maintaining a healthy credit score can indirectly benefit your car insurance costs.
The make, model, and year of your car affect your insurance premiums. Vehicles with high safety ratings and anti-theft devices may qualify for discounts. Expensive vehicles generally have higher insurance costs due to the higher repair or replacement value.
The level of coverage you choose directly impacts your premium. While comprehensive and collision coverage offer greater protection, they also come with higher costs. Carefully assess your needs to determine the appropriate coverage level.
